There are several quality webcams that look as good as regular cameras these days. Elgato Facecam Pro and Facecam MK2. Osbots line of cameras. Insta 360s line of cameras. And on a budget, even the EMEET 4K camera. I was using a Canon SL2's and moved to Elgato cameras and the quality is good with zero complaints from viewers. And the software for webcams is easier and faster to make adjustments on than it is for DSLR/Mirrorless cameras in many cases. So, I'd say if you're mostly filming from your deck or some stationary situation, a high quality webcam will more than take care of your needs.
